Instrumentation, OP Amps, Buffer Amps Microchip Technology MCP6002-E/MCVAO Overview

Introducing the MCP6002-E/MCVAO, a cutting-edge integrated circuit engineered by Microchip Technology. This high-performance operational amplifier boasts a dual general-purpose design, making it an exceptional choice for a wide range of applications in the instrumentation, OP amps, and buffer amps category. With its compact 8-DFN package, this IC delivers unparalleled versatility and reliability, meeting the demanding standards of modern electronic systems.

MCP6002-E/MCVAO Features

  • Dual operational amplifier configuration
  • General-purpose circuit design
  • Compact 8-DFN package
  • High performance and reliability
  • Wide range of operating voltages: 1.8V to 6.0V
  • Low input offset voltage: ±4 mV
  • Low quiescent current: 100 μA per amplifier
  • Unity-gain stable

MCP6002-E/MCVAO Applications

  • Signal conditioning: Ideal for precision instrumentation and sensor applications where accurate amplification of small signals is critical. This IC can be integrated into data acquisition systems, medical instrumentation, and industrial automation equipment.
  • Active filters: Enables the implementation of active filter circuits in audio equipment, communications devices, and signal processing systems. Its dual op-amp configuration allows for versatile filter designs with high performance and reliability.
  • Voltage followers: Suitable for buffering and voltage level shifting applications in battery-powered devices, portable electronics, and low-power sensor nodes. The MCP6002-E/MCVAO ensures efficient signal transmission and impedance matching in various electronic systems.
